2015-07-31 19:35:17 +02:00
|
|
|
bashish (theme enviroment for text terminals).
|
|
|
|
|
2016-11-11 21:46:20 +01:00
|
|
|
Bashish is a theme enviroment for text terminals. It can change
|
|
|
|
colors, font, transparency and background image on a per-application
|
|
|
|
basis. Additionally Bashish supports prompt changing on common shells
|
|
|
|
such as bash, zsh and tcsh.
|
2015-07-31 19:35:17 +02:00
|
|
|
|
|
|
|
Bashish runs on most terminal emulators available.
|
|
|
|
|
|
|
|
Bashish is great for people who:
|
|
|
|
|
|
|
|
* Want a good looking prompt.
|
|
|
|
* Want to configure the apperance of the terminal.
|
|
|
|
* Want informative titles based on the command arguments.
|
|
|
|
* Need different fonts for different applications - eg. Chinese, Japanese,
|
2016-11-11 21:46:20 +01:00
|
|
|
OEM Terminal fonts.
|
|
|
|
* While many of these features would be simple to implement as aliases or
|
|
|
|
shell scripts, the tricky part where Bashish excels is that it does not
|
|
|
|
affect the enviroment noticeably.
|
2015-07-31 19:35:17 +02:00
|
|
|
|
|
|
|
As an example, Bashish provides themes even if the themed application is run
|
|
|
|
in a pipe, this without affecting the pipe at all.
|
|
|
|
|
2016-11-11 21:46:20 +01:00
|
|
|
Additionally there is no need to rewrite your aliases or functions since
|
|
|
|
Bashish provides theming through shell script wrappers.
|
2015-07-31 19:35:17 +02:00
|
|
|
|
2016-11-11 21:46:20 +01:00
|
|
|
To enable Bashish, simply run " bashish ", press ENTER key and hit Ctrl+C
|
|
|
|
to quit.
|
2015-07-31 19:35:17 +02:00
|
|
|
|
2016-11-11 21:46:20 +01:00
|
|
|
To choose another theme, see the theme list with "bashish list" and to
|
|
|
|
enable a new theme simply run "bashish theme_name".
|